Order of the National Green Tribunal in the matter of M/s. Deccan Explotech Pvt. Ltd. Vs Ministry of Environment and Forest & Climate Change & Others dated 08/05/2019 regarding illegal running of stone crushing and mining unit in village Yewat, Taluka Daund, District Pune, Maharashtra. It is alleged that requisite clearances have not been obtained and pollution norms are not being followed causing both air and water pollution in the area affecting adversely the environment, health of the people as well as wildlife.
